John Buckridge currently serves as the Chief Executive Officer of Spartan Aerospace Group, LLC and Executive Chairman of Turbine Engine Specialists, LLC; both portfolio companies under his purview as the Aerospace & Defense Fund Operating Partner for The Edgewater Funds. John previously led Berkshire Hathaway’s Marmon Group Aerospace and Metal Services Division as President, overseeing global operations across 45 locations in eight countries and driving revenue growth to $1.3 billion through strategic acquisitions. Earlier in his career, Buckridge was Managing Director at B/E Aerospace, joining the company after it acquired Altis Aero Systems, which he founded. His leadership there also focused on acquisition-driven growth.
He studied English and Engineering at the University of New Haven and Massachusetts Maritime Academy, served five years in the U.S. Navy, and completed executive negotiation programs at MIT and Harvard Law School.
